Even in terms of widgets per hour, you need to be VERY careful to include measures of quality.

1 - Underlying defects will absolutely sink your downstream production rate.

2 - If you only measure widgets per hour, the machine will make more, but smaller widgets (See Soviet Nail factory story - https://skeptics.stackexchange.com/questions/22375/did-a-sov... )

3 - Quality has a quantity all it's own. Many times, better widgets will improve efficiency many times over their own cost of production.
